E–Bonifacio (1), Tracy (2). DP–Washington 2. Zimmerman-Kennedy-Dunn, Kennedy-Gonzalez-Dunn, Florida 1. Bonifacio-Ramirez-G. Sanchez. 2B–Washington Dunn (33,off Sanabia); Morse (8,off Sanabia); Kennedy (15,off Badenhop), Florida Maybin (5,off Marquis). 3B–Washington Bernadina (3,off Miller). HR–Washington Zimmerman (25,3rd inning off Sanabia 2 on 1 out); Dunn (33,7th inning off Sanches 2 on 2 out), Florida Ramirez (19,1st inning off Marquis 0 on 2 out); Hayes (2,6th inning off Marquis 1 on 2 out). SF–Desmond (6,off Miller). IBB–Morgan (1,by Sanabia); Dunn (9,by Miller). Team LOB–7. HBP–Stanton (1,by Marquis). Team–8. SB–Bernadina (13,2nd base off Sanches/Hayes); Bonifacio (6,2nd base off Marquis/Rodriguez). U-HP–Mike Estabrook, 1B–Jim Wolf, 2B–Marvin Hudson, 3B–Derryl Cousins. T–3:05. A–18,326. |
